Course/Module aims:
Developing ethical thinking and understanding of students intending to become clinical psychologists.

Learning outcomes - On successful completion of this module, students should be able to:
Capacity for ethical thinking and understanding. Acquaintance and knowledge in rules, ethical codes and regulations related to professional work.

Attendance requirements(%):

Teaching arrangement and method of instruction: lectures and discussions based on reading. Discussion of Ethical and professional issues presented by students stemming from their practicum experiences.
